Binance Founder CZ Joins Pakistan Crypto Council as Strategic Advisor, Signaling Web3 Growth Vision

In a landmark development for Pakistan’s emerging digital economy, Changpeng Zhao (CZ), the renowned founder of Binance and a pioneering figure in the global Web3 ecosystem, has officially been appointed as Strategic Advisor to the Pakistan Crypto Council (PCC). The announcement was made on April 7, 2025, during a high-level meeting chaired by Federal Minister for Finance and Revenue, Senator Muhammad Aurangzeb, who also serves as Chairman of the PCC.

The gathering marked a major convergence of government and crypto leadership, bringing together key stakeholders including the Chairman of the Securities and Exchange Commission of Pakistan (SECP), the Governor of the State Bank of Pakistan (SBP), and Federal Secretaries for Law and IT. The event showcased the Pakistani government’s increasingly proactive stance on crypto and digital finance.

During his visit, CZ also held separate meetings with the Prime Minister and the Deputy Prime Minister of Pakistan, signaling the gravity of his appointment and the country’s ambition to become a serious player in the global Web3 landscape. This marks a new chapter in Pakistan’s approach to digital innovation, one that positions it alongside forward-thinking nations such as Singapore, Switzerland, and the UAE.

“This is a landmark moment for Pakistan,” stated Senator Aurangzeb. “We are sending a clear message to the world: Pakistan is open for innovation. With CZ onboard, we are accelerating our vision to make Pakistan a regional powerhouse for Web3, digital finance, and blockchain-driven growth.”

CZ’s addition to the PCC comes at a time when Pakistan is working to develop a compliant and robust framework for blockchain technology and cryptocurrency adoption. As Strategic Advisor, CZ will play a crucial role in shaping regulatory policies, advising on the development of digital infrastructure, and supporting education and awareness efforts to enable safe and widespread adoption of blockchain technologies.

“Pakistan is opening its doors to the future of finance,” said Bilal Bin Saqib, CEO of the Pakistan Crypto Council. “And who better to guide us on this journey than CZ, a pioneer who built the world’s largest crypto exchange and changed the way billions think about financial freedom.”

CZ also expressed his optimism about Pakistan’s potential in the Web3 space. “Pakistan is a country of 240 million people, over 60 percent of whom are under the age of 30. The potential here is limitless,” he said in a statement.

His involvement is expected to catalyze significant movement in the country’s regulatory landscape, opening doors for startups, investors, and developers eager to engage in crypto, blockchain, and DeFi sectors. With an already growing interest in digital finance among Pakistan’s youth, CZ’s strategic input may very well transform the country into a regional leader in Web3 innovation.

The appointment sends a strong message to global markets and investors: Pakistan is ready to embrace the future of finance, and it’s doing so with some of the most influential minds in the industry guiding the way.

CWPK Legacy
Launched in 1967 internationally, ComputerWorld is the oldest tech magazine/media property in the world. In Pakistan, ComputerWorld was launched in 1995. Initially providing news to IT executives only, once CIO Pakistan, its sister brand from the same family, was launched and took over the enterprise reporting domain in Pakistan, CWPK has emerged as a holistic technology media platform reporting everything tech in the country. It remains the oldest continuous IT publishing brand in the country and in 2025 is set to turn 30 years old, which will be its biggest benchmark and a legacy it hopes to continue for years to come. CWPK is part of the SPIN/IDG Wakhan media umbrella.
